Walkthrough

Adjusts etcd alert thresholds and definitions, adds a new etcdHighFsyncDurations alert, removes older fsync alerts from the PrometheusRule, adds the new alert to the jsonnet exclusion list, and updates a dependency SHA in jsonnetfile.lock.json.

Changes

Cohort / File(s) Summary of Changes
Prometheus alerts: etcd thresholds and rules
jsonnet/custom.libsonnet, manifests/0000_90_etcd-operator_03_prometheusrule.yaml
Lowered etcdHighCommitDurations threshold from > 0.5 to > 0.025. Added new etcdHighFsyncDurations alert (etcd_disk_wal_fsync_duration_seconds_bucket > 0.010, for: 10m, severity: critical) with annotations and runbook URL. Removed older fsync alert variants from the PrometheusRule.
Jsonnet wiring: alert exclusions
jsonnet/main.jsonnet
Added etcdHighFsyncDurations to the excludedAlerts list; no other logic changes.
Dependencies lockfile update
jsonnet/jsonnetfile.lock.json
Updated a dependency entry SHA (first dependency version changed); lockfile sums/other fields unchanged.

109-109: Verify the 25ms commit threshold is intentional and appropriate for all platforms.

The web search confirms your concern: industry standard warning thresholds are 0.25s (250ms) for etcd commit p99 latency. The operational guidance from etcd documentation recommends aiming for backend/apply p99 ~25ms, which is an operational target, not an alert threshold.

Your PR sets the alert at 0.025s (25ms)—aligning with the operational target rather than industry-standard alert thresholds. This 10x reduction below common practice could generate frequent alerts on healthy systems.

Please confirm:

  1. This threshold was intentionally chosen (not an accidental unit conversion)
  2. It has been validated to avoid excessive false-positives across AWS, Azure, GCP, bare metal, and other supported platforms
  3. Whether this aligns with OpenShift product requirements or customer SLOs

Critical severity with 10ms fsync threshold may cause excessive alerts.

The new etcdHighFsyncDurations alert uses a 10ms threshold with critical severity. This is extremely aggressive compared to:

  • The removed alerts which used 0.5s and 1s thresholds
  • Typical etcd recommendations of 100ms-1s for fsync warnings
  • Storage performance characteristics on cloud providers and network-attached storage

While 10ms is appropriate for local NVMe SSDs, many OpenShift deployments use cloud block storage or other configurations where 10ms fsync at 99th percentile is unrealistic. This could result in:

  • Frequent critical pages causing alert fatigue
  • Operational burden investigating false positives
  • Difficulty distinguishing real storage issues from infrastructure limitations

Please verify:

  1. This threshold has been validated not to cause excessive alerts across all supported platforms
  2. Whether this should remain at critical severity or be downgraded to warning
  3. Consider the etcdGRPCRequestsSlow alert (lines 90-104) which uses platform-specific thresholds (1.5s for Azure, 1s for others) - should fsync also account for platform differences?

Severity miscategorized: 10ms fsync alert should be warning, not critical.

Based on etcd alerting standards, a 10ms (0.01s) threshold represents the healthy performance target for 99th percentile fsync—not a degradation threshold. The actual problem is the severity level:

Recommended thresholds:

  • Healthy target: < 10ms
  • Warning: ≥ 0.5s
  • Critical: ≥ 1s

The current alert fires as critical whenever fsync slightly exceeds the healthy baseline, which will cause excessive paging and alert fatigue.

Recommended fix: Either downgrade this alert to warning severity, or restructure with tiered alerts (warning at 0.5s, critical at 1s) to match standard etcd alerting practices. Also verify whether this should account for platform differences, similar to the etcdGRPCRequestsSlow alert (lines 90-104).
